A Blackline Safety Case Study
Northern Ireland Water, the sole provider of water and sewage services in Northern Ireland, needed a better way to protect its frontline teams from hazardous gases and lone worker risks. Its existing portable gas monitors did not provide real-time readings, had no connectivity, and could not support two-way communication, creating delays in retrieving safety data and gaps in visibility.
Northern Ireland Water selected Blackline Safety’s G7c wearable cloud-connected multi-gas monitors with integrated cellular connectivity and indoor location compatibility. The devices gave the team real-time gas readings, GPS and indoor location visibility, messaging, and a green connectivity light that confirmed workers were connected to the Blackline Safety network, even underground. Northern Ireland Water purchased over 700 G7c devices to help keep more than 500 frontline workers protected and improve real-time communication and safety oversight.
